30/3/2017 09:20 | New technical (non exec) director appointment to support GUN oil & Gas strategy: Appointment of Director The board of Gunsynd is pleased to announce the appointment of David Ormerod as a Non-Executive Director with immediate effect. David is an experienced oil and gas professional who has been involved in public companies at a management and board level for thirty years. He has experience with operations in Africa, Asia, US, South America and Australia where he has been involved in business development, initial drilling through to field development. He is a member of the AAPG, SEG and a fellow of the Royal Geological Society. He adds technical governance and strategy at a critical time in the development of the company. Hamish Harris, Gunsynd Executive Chairman, commented: "This is a very significant appointment for the Company with regard to its oil and gas strategy. David Ormerod brings not only a wealth of technical expertise but just as importantly experience in dealing with licence acquisitions at a government level. This appointment greatly enhances the ability of Gunsynd to being able to not only find but pursue oil and gas deals at a direct working interest level".
